What does "sum" mean?
-
noun The total obtained by adding numbers or quantities together.
"The sum of five and three is eight."
-
noun An amount of money.
"He was fined a large sum for the violation."
-
verb To add numbers or items together, or to summarize.
"The spreadsheet automatically sums the column."
